UK and Welsh Governments team up to tackle record high NHS waiting lists in Wales
It comes as NHS waiting times in Wales continue to reach record highs. Last week Wrexham.com reported that there are more than 616,000 patients in Wales waiting to begin their NHS treatment. The worrying new figures are the equivalent of one-in-four people in Wales on a waiting list.
